前言:為什麼 Cursor 會連接超時?
進入 2026 年,Cursor AI 已經成為全球程式設計師不可或缺的生產力工具。然而,由於其後台高度依賴 Anthropic 的 Claude 系列模型以及 OpenAI 的伺服器集群,身處特定網絡環境下的用戶經常會遇到「Connection Timeout」或「Server Error」的報錯。這通常不是因為你的網絡斷了,而是因為 Cursor 的底層通訊機制觸發了防火牆攔截,或是你的代理工具未能正確接管其流量。
Cursor 與一般的瀏覽器應用不同,它基於 VS Code 二次開發,內置了大量的 gRPC 通訊和 WebSocket 長連接。如果你的 Clash 僅僅開啟了普通的系統代理,往往無法捕捉到這些非 HTTP 協議的流量。本文將從核心原理出發,帶你徹底解決 Cursor AI 的連接問題。
修復目標
實現 Cursor Chat 零延遲回覆、Composer 功能正常同步、以及 AI 程式碼補全(Copilot)的流暢體驗。
1優化 Clash 分流規則集
Cursor 的服務並非只運行在單一域名下。除了 cursor.sh,它還調用了大量的雲端資源。如果你的規則不全,部分關鍵請求會走直連(DIRECT),導致連接握手失敗。
必備規則清單
請將以下內容添加到你的 Clash 配置檔案(YAML)的 rules 模塊頂部:
小撇步
建議將 Cursor 專屬規則指向一個穩定、延遲低的「美國」或「新加坡」節點。AI 服務對 IP 的乾淨程度有一定要求,避免使用頻繁跳轉的負載均衡節點。
很多用戶反應,即使添加了域名規則,Cursor 依然無法連接。這是因為 Cursor 內部集成了大量的二進制通訊,這些流量有時會跳過域名解析直接通過 IP 地址訪問。此時,我們需要更高級的接管手段。
2開啟 TUN 模式解決底層通訊
這是解決 Cursor 連接問題的「終極武器」。TUN 模式會在系統層面創建一個虛擬網卡,強制接管所有應用程序的流量,無論它是 HTTP、TCP 還是 UDP。
- 打開 Clash Verge Rev 或 Clash for Windows。
- 進入「設置」或「Settings」,找到 TUN Mode 開關。
- 點擊安裝虛擬網卡驅動(Wintun)。
- 重啟 Clash,並確保開關顯示為綠色激活狀態。
管理員權限
開啟 TUN 模式通常需要管理員權限。如果失敗,請右鍵點擊 Clash 圖標選擇「以管理員身份運行」。
- 在 Clash 客戶端中點擊「Install Enhanced Mode」。
- 輸入系統密碼以授權安裝 Network Extension。
- 在系統設置中允許「Clash」添加 VPN 配置。
開啟 TUN 模式後,Cursor 的所有通訊請求都會經過 Clash 的規則檢查,漏網之魚將不復存在。
3配置系統環境變數與 IDE 代理
有時 Cursor 作為一個開發工具,會調用系統底層的 curl 或 git 來下載 AI 模型或插件。這些底層工具往往不遵循普通的系統代理設置。
手動設置環境變數
在你的終端(PowerShell 或 zsh)中執行以下命令,確保環境變數已正確指向 Clash 的本地端口(默認 7890):
Cursor 內部代理設置
進入 Cursor 的 Settings -> Proxy,將代理模式設置為 Manual 或 Override,並填入 127.0.0.1:7890。這樣可以確保 IDE 本身在發起 AI 請求時優先尋找本地代理通道,而不是直接去撞牆。
4解決 DNS 污染與 WebRTC 洩露
2026 年,Cursor AI 增強了對用戶地理位置的檢測。如果你的 DNS 請求洩露了真實的運營商地址,即使流量走了代理,AI 伺服器依然會拒絕服務。
在 Clash 中配置 Fake-IP 模式是目前最優的解決方案:
通過 Fake-IP,Clash 會先給 Cursor 一個虛擬地址,然後由 Clash 在遠端伺服器進行真實解析。這能徹底杜絕本地運營商的 DNS 干擾。此外,建議在瀏覽器中關閉 WebRTC,防止 IP 洩露,雖然 Cursor 是獨立應用,但其內部渲染引擎同樣適用此邏輯。
總結:Clash 如何賦能 AI 開發
面對日益複雜的 AI 開發環境,傳統的 VPN 工具往往顯得笨重且不可控。相比之下,Clash 展現出了無可比擬的優勢:
- 精確分流: 只有 AI 流量走代理,國內查閱 Github 或 StackOverflow 依然直連,速度飛快。
- 協議支持: 完美支持 gRPC,這對 2026 年的 Cursor 通訊至關重要。
- 高度自定義: 可以針對不同的 AI 工具(如 Cursor, ChatGPT, Midjourney)配置不同的節點策略。
如果您還在使用不穩定的免費代理或配置不當的客戶端,現在是時候切換到專業的 Clash 解決方案了。穩定、高速的網絡環境是 AI 編程體驗的基石。